Fixing a bug where self.ship can be None

1 parent bedae2d commit 4348aba88dc2013f27774aad991f8672ae01e6a8 @asweigart committed
@@ -356,7 +356,7 @@ def handle_collisions(self, delta_t):
for b in self.bubbles:
if self.bullet != None and b.collides_with(self.bullet):
- if not self.ship.has_super_bullets():
+ if self.ship != None and not self.ship.has_super_bullets():
self.bullet = None
# Push it along or it will just

